Pennsylvania Payroll Employment By County for The Local Government Service Providing Industry in May, 2020
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in May, 2020, Pennsylvania added -2,632 number of jobs to the local government service-providing industry. Among Pennsylvania counties, Lackawanna added the highest number of jobs (80), followed by Carbon (69), and Beaver (60).
